Summary

Parallel Search is a new web search API designed specifically for AI applications, offering higher accuracy on complex queries that require multi-hop reasoning, deep comprehension of hard-to-crawl content, and synthesis across scattered sources. The article positions Parallel as superior to traditional search APIs, particularly for challenging queries that span multiple topics or require multiple reasoning steps, achieving better performance on specialized benchmarks while being more cost-effective.
